Cosmetic services definition

Cosmetic services means dental work that improves the appearance of the teeth, gums, or bite, including, but not limited to, inlays or onlays, composite bonding, dental veneers, teeth whitening, or braces.
Cosmetic services means surgery that is performed to alter or reshape normal structures of the body in order to improve appearance. This exclusion does not apply to Reconstructive Surgery for breast symmetry after a mastectomy, surgery to correct birth defects and birth abnormalities, or any surgery to correct deformities caused by congenital or developmental abnormalities, illness, or injury for the purpose of improving bodily function or symptomology or creating a normal appearance.
